23 June 2020 By Elaine Murphy elaine@TheCork.ie Jameson producer Irish Distillers has announced the appointment of Katherine Condon as Distiller at Midleton Distillery. Katherine will report to newly appointed Master Distiller, Kevin O’Gorman, with responsibility for the production process from brewing to distillation.
